Conference Statistics
  • 318 papers (28 acceptance)
  • 54 oral presentations (4.7)
  • 1136 submissions
  • 30 area chairs, 560 reviewers
  • 1200 attendees (30 increase)

Awards
  • Honored 5 champion reviewers
  • Best Paper
  • Putting Objects in Perspective
  • D. Hoiem, A. Efros, M. Herbert
  • Honorable mention Incremental Learning of Object
    Detectors Using a Visual Shape Alphabet
  • A. Opelt, A. Pinz, A. Zisserman
  • Best Poster TBA.

4
Longuet-Higgins Prize (CVPR 96)
  • Neural Network-Based Face Detection
  • H. Rowley, S. Baluja, T. Kanade
  • Combining Greyvalue Invariants with Local
    Constraints for Object Recognition
  • C. Schmid, R. Mohr

Bilayer Segmentation of Live Video
  • A. Criminisi, G. Cross, A. Blake, V. Kolmogorov
    Link
  • Goals
  • Single camera
  • Real-time (no optic flow!)
  • Good looking results

21
How it works
  • Priors, priors, priors and priors
  • Temporal continuity
  • Spatial coherence
  • Color likelihood
  • Motion likelihood
  • Learning
  • Fast approximate binary graph cut

22
A Closed Form Solution to Natural Image Matting
  • Anat Levin, Dani Lischinski, Yair Weiss
  • Idea in a small window, colors lie on a line in
    color space
  • Find alpha by minimizing aT L a
  • Eigenvectors of L suggest good scribbles

Multi-View Stereo Evaluation
  • S. Seitz, B. Curless, J Diebel, D Scharstein, R
    Szeliski
  • http//vision.middlebury.edu/mview

27
Multi-View Stereo Taxonomy
  • Scene representation
  • Photo-consistency measure
  • Visibility model
  • Shape prior
  • Reconstruction algorithm
  • Initialization

28
Multi-View Stereo Evaluation
  • Metrics
  • Accuracy
  • Completeness
  • Running time
  • Renderings
  • Conclusions
  • Most work pretty well
  • Having lots of views enables simpler algorithms
    Multi-view Stereo Revisited, Goesele et al
